Transaction e204066632519c203ae3f83520f1091889386e5bc3c51ca4f8d20a408450969f
1 Input
1 Output
-
e204066632519c203ae3f83520f1091889386e5bc3c51ca4f8d20a408450969f:0
- value
- 1736259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0683bbe5833f9d0aefda674314308746aa658adf OP_EQUAL
- address
- 32HTnjNzpRoH67QHE2ZAPoZr6sUg7PDXGV